What a will in fact does for you in New York

A will certainly informs the surrogate's court just how to distribute your probate properties. That "probate" qualifier issues. Not whatever you have goes through probate. Jointly held building, pension with beneficiaries, life insurance with named beneficiaries, and assets in a properly moneyed count on generally bypass the will totally. Several families uncover this far too late when the will certainly leaves a legacy to a youngster, but the biggest accounts currently went by recipient designation to somebody else. The will certainly can only control what ends up in the probate estate, so control is critical.

The framework of an uncomplicated will in Albany Region frequently consists of a couple of crucial elements. You call an administrator you count on and an alternate in instance your front runner can not offer. You offer clear gifts, such as particular buck amounts or things, then direct the residue of the estate, typically with percentage shares instead of set numbers that can go stale. If you have minor youngsters, you nominate a guardian. You also consist of a self-proving sworn statement so your witnesses do not need to appear in court later. The magic remains in clearness. Language ought to leave little space for interpretation, particularly where blended households, estranged loved ones, or closely held services are involved.

When counts on make good sense, and when they're overkill

Trusts aren't a standing sign, they're a tool. In the Capital Region, I suggest them in a few situations. If you possess residential property in numerous states, a revocable living trust can prevent multiple probates, conserving time and legal costs. If privacy issues, counts on maintain circulations out of the public probate document. If you have a child who requires financial guardrails, a trust fund can startle distributions and assign a trustworthy fiduciary to handle the funds. And if you're expecting potential Medicaid eligibility for lasting treatment, an irrevocable trust can safeguard assets when produced and moneyed very early enough.

A revocable living trust is flexible. You can serve as your own trustee, and you can rewrite or withdraw it throughout your life. It does not, nonetheless, safeguard properties from your financial institutions or nursing home prices while you're alive. Its worth is management: it enhances administration if you become incapacitated and can make your ultimate estate negotiation extra efficient.

An irrevocable trust, by comparison, is a commitment. Once you place possessions in it and give up direct accessibility, those possessions start the five-year Medicaid lookback clock for assisted living home protection. You still could receive trust fund revenue, yet the primary generally will not be countable if the lookback has run out and the trust fund is drafted well. I've seen customers think twice at this threshold. They fear losing control. The workaround is good style: name a trustee you rely on, retain specific minimal powers that don't endanger Medicaid protections, and maintain enough fluid properties outside the depend on for comfort. The most effective time to begin this preparation frequents your late 60s or early 70s, earlier if there's a household background of cognitive illness. Waiting until a situation limits your options.

Powers of lawyer and healthcare choices that really work when needed

A lovely will certainly doesn't aid if you live and incapacitated. I've had households race right into my workplace with healthcare facility wristbands still on, intending to authorize a power of attorney in the nick of time. That's not always feasible. Without one, your loved ones might wind up in guardianship court, which relocates at the speed of government, not the rate of an emergency.

New York's legal short form Power of Attorney was upgraded in 2021, and the information issue. If you want your agent to make significant presents or fund specific trust funds, you require the right alterations. Banks in Albany and Saratoga County have a tendency to be sticklers about example signatures, initials on each section, and precise statutory language. When the type is appropriate, your representative can manage financial, real estate, and tax obligation matters without hitting a brick wall.

For wellness selections, a Health Care Proxy and a Living Will certainly collaborate. The proxy has to do with that determines; the living will has to do with what you desire. Families take a breath much easier when these records are crisp and specific. Define your choices around artificial nutrition, discomfort administration, and end-of-life support. If you really feel strongly concerning remaining in a particular facility near home, state so. And make sure the proxy recognizes where the files live. A binder on a shelf is less handy than a checked duplicate on a phone when a cosmetic surgeon needs it prior to a procedure.

Long-term care facts in the Resources Region

Sticker shock is genuine. Personal pay prices for assisted living home in the Albany-Saratoga passage frequently land between 13,000 and 16,000 monthly, often much more for specialized memory treatment. Home treatment has its very own costs, and while New York's Medicaid program provides community-based services, the qualification rules are detailed and adjustment periodically.

The preparation levers know yet nuanced. You consider assets, income, and the five-year lookback for assisted living facility treatment. You take into consideration spousal securities for a healthy and balanced partner who still lives in the house, including the Neighborhood Partner Source Allocation and spousal refusal where suitable. You take care of regular monthly income via a pooled earnings trust fund if you're pursuing community Medicaid. You place the home thoroughly, considering that primary house guidelines differ from fluid properties, and transfers to specific loved ones can be exempt.

Timing issues. If you're four years right into an irrevocable trust strategy, and a diagnosis presses you towards center care, you may use a partial return strategy or a promissory note strategy to manage the staying months of direct exposure. If you didn't plan ahead, you might still salvage significant possessions using spousal transfers, caregiver contracts, or tactical spend-downs that include value, such as home adjustments to allow a spouse to remain securely at home. The peaceful power of recipient designations

Retirement accounts and life insurance move by paperwork, not by will clauses. Testimonial those recipient classifications every couple of years, especially after life events like marriage, divorce, births, or deaths. I've seen too many accounts still naming an ex-spouse or, worse, the estate, which can accelerate tax obligations or activate probate needlessly. If minor youngsters are recipients, name a trust for them instead of guiding funds outright. A tiny tweak on a custodian's web site today can avoid an icy account or a costly court proceeding tomorrow.

Coordinating beneficiaries with tax obligation planning additionally matters. Often you want philanthropic beneficiaries called on pre-tax pension and family members https://propertycapitalregion.image-perth.org/real-estate-contract-review-backups-every-purchaser-should-consist-of to get Roth accounts or after-tax possessions. The charity pays no income tax on the IRA dollars, while your household prevents acquiring a tax costs. These are the kinds of modest modifications that can add actual worth without elegant strategies.

Taxes, right-sized

Most family members in Albany County don't pay federal inheritance tax since the federal exemption remains high. New York's estate tax is a various story. The state's exception is lower and consists of a well-known cliff, where if your taxed estate surpasses the exemption by greater than 5 percent, the whole exemption vaporizes. This can produce a painful outcome for estates that are just modestly above the line.

A few techniques can soften the blow. Life time gifting, if done early and with a clear proof, can keep you under the limit. For couples, credit scores sanctuary intending with trust funds can preserve both exceptions. Charitable bequests can additionally help if aligned with your values. Do not neglect income taxes either. A well-timed step-up in basis at death can decrease resources gains on appreciated stock or real estate for your heirs. It prevails to hold onto low-basis possessions in a revocable trust therefore, while using high-basis or cash money possessions for life time gifts.

Documents that make their keep

Paper alone will not conserve you. Execution and maintenance matter. New York has witnessing demands for wills, and notarization needs for powers of attorney and healthcare papers. Usage witnesses who aren't recipients. Shop originals where your administrator can locate them, and tell your internal circle that holds copies. Every three to 5 years, timetable an appointment. Regulations change, households change, and asset degrees change. Also tiny updates, like adding a follower trustee or refreshing a power of attorney to the existing legal type, can make the distinction when a financial institution or healthcare facility is scanning for reasons to claim no.

Titling is the quiet saboteur. If you create a revocable trust but don't fund it, your plan will not function as intended. Relocate accounts right into the count on or retitle them appropriately. Change beneficiary classifications to name the count on when proper, specifically for life insurance policy planned to support minors or a partner with memory problems. When you purchase or sell realty, loop your coordinator and your property closing lawyer right into the procedure. I have actually fixed a lot of strategies that were best till a hurried closing deeded a brand-new home to the wrong owners or failed to remember the trust fund entirely.
